| 3. After finishing his studies, Kulwant left home due to parental disapproval and worked as a waiter in a Goa restaurant. |
| 4. He attempted to join the Army but was unsuccessful. |
| 5. In pursuit of his cricketing dream, he moved to Delhi without his parents' knowledge. |
| 6. Kulwant received cricket training at the 'Lal Bahadur Shastri Cricket Academy' in Delhi under Coach Sanjay Bhardwaj. |
| 7. He made his 'List A' debut for Delhi in 2017, taking 3 wickets against Himachal Pradesh in the Vijay Hazare Trophy. |
| 8. Due to his strong performances, he played for the Indian Board Presidentβs XI. |
| 9. In the 2017 IPL auction, Mumbai Indians (MI) bought him for Rs. 10 lakhs. |
| 10. For the 2018 IPL season,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) acquired him for Rs. 85 lakhs. |

| 12. In October 2018, in the quarter-finals of the 2018β19 Vijay Hazare Trophy, he took a hat-trick for Delhi against Haryana, finishing with figures of six wickets for 31 runs from his ten overs. |
| 13. He made his first-class debut for Delhi in the 2017β18 Ranji Trophy on 6 October 2017. |
| 14. He made his Twenty20 debut for Delhi in the 2017β18 Zonal T20 League on 9 January 2018. |
